The verdict

Cedar Acres Mobile Home Park sits in the upper third of the sitemap cohort by violation count (825), so the tables below sample a dense compliance trail rather than a near-clean ledger. Population served is smaller (95; smaller served population (≤ 999)), so each violation row represents a compact service footprint. Health-based share is 2% (middle-third health share (≤ 23%)). No UCMR5 PFAS test appears for this system in this extract.
